Fitch Ratings is seeking an Associate Director level credit analyst for our Latin America department to cover non-financial corporate credits, primarily in Energy and Utilities related sectors. The successful candidate for this position must be able to demonstrate skills and experience that will allow for immediate primary coverage of a multi-country portfolio of Latin American Corporate credits.

Primary duties associated with the portfolio of companies include: conducting onsite meetings with senior corporate management in the region, performing analysis of key quantitative and qualitative factors, detailed financial modeling; presenting companies to Fitch's internal credit rating committee; communicating ratings and rating rationale to senior management; interacting with investors, sell-side analysts and media; public speaking on the sector(s); and writing and publishing press releases and research reports. Position will also require active role in assisting in related
industry studies as well as active participation in national ratings conducted by regional offices.

Position Requirements

The successful candidate must possess at least 3-5 years relevant experience; strong credit skills and knowledge of corporate credit and industry analysis are required. Strong English writing skills, a solid foundation of analytical skills and well-developed interpersonal communication skills are required. Knowledge of Microsoft Word, Excel and Power Point is necessary. MBA and/or CFA preferred. Ability to speak Spanish and/or Portuguese is a plus.

Fitch is committed to providing global securities markets with objective, timely, independent and forward-looking credit opinions. To protect Fitch's credibility and reputation, our employees must take every precaution to avoid conflicts of interests or any appearance of a conflict of interest. Should you be successful in the recruitment process at Fitch Ratings you will asked to declare any securities holdings and other potential conflicts for you and your Family Members prior to commencing employment. If you, or your Family Members, have any holdings that may conflict with your work responsibilities, they must be sold before beginning work. In certain roles, employees and their Family Members may be limited to investments in diversified mutual funds only.
